  • What Makes the Giant Oceanic Manta Ray So Unique?

    The giant oceanic manta ray stands out among marine creatures due to its extraordinary physical and behavioral traits. Unlike other rays, which often dwell near the seafloor, the giant oceanic manta ray is a pelagic species, meaning it spends most of its life in the open ocean. This lifestyle has shaped its evolution, resulting in a streamlined body and the ability to cover vast distances in search of food.

    One of the most striking features of the giant oceanic manta ray is its immense size. With a wingspan that can exceed 23 feet (7 meters), it dwarfs many other marine animals. Despite its size, this ray is incredibly agile, capable of performing acrobatic flips and somersaults while feeding. Its mouth, located on the front of its head, allows it to filter large quantities of plankton and small fish from the water, making it a key player in maintaining the health of marine ecosystems.

    Another unique aspect of the giant oceanic manta ray is its intelligence. These rays are known to exhibit complex social behaviors, such as forming feeding aggregations and interacting with divers. They also possess the largest brain-to-body ratio of any fish, suggesting a high level of cognitive ability. Their ability to recognize and remember individuals, both human and animal, further highlights their intelligence.

    How Do Their Physical Features Support Their Lifestyle?

    The physical features of the giant oceanic manta ray are perfectly adapted to its pelagic lifestyle. Its flattened body and wide pectoral fins allow it to glide effortlessly through the water, conserving energy during long migrations. The cephalic fins, located on either side of its mouth, help funnel plankton into its mouth while feeding.

    Additionally, the ray's countershading coloration—dark on top and light underneath—provides camouflage from predators. This adaptation helps it blend into the depths when viewed from above and into the sunlight when viewed from below. The unique spot patterns on its underside also serve as a natural identifier, much like a fingerprint, allowing researchers to track individual rays.

  • Feeding is a central part of their behavior. Giant oceanic manta rays are filter feeders, using their gill rakers to trap plankton and small fish. They often perform somersaults while feeding, a behavior known as "barrel rolling," which maximizes their intake of food. This feeding technique is not only efficient but also mesmerizing to witness.

    Migration is another key aspect of their lifestyle. These rays are known to travel thousands of miles across oceans, following seasonal changes in plankton abundance. Such long-distance migrations are essential for their survival, as they ensure access to food and suitable breeding grounds. Their ability to navigate vast distances with precision remains a subject of scientific interest.

    What Are Their Social Interactions Like?

    Despite their solitary nature, giant oceanic manta rays are not entirely antisocial. They often interact with other rays and even humans during feeding or cleaning events. Cleaning stations, where smaller fish remove parasites from the rays' skin, are popular social hubs. These interactions are mutually beneficial, as the rays receive grooming while the cleaner fish gain a food source.

    Research has shown that giant oceanic manta rays can recognize and remember individual humans. This ability has been observed in controlled studies, where rays consistently approached familiar divers and exhibited curiosity toward them. Such behavior underscores their intelligence and capacity for social learning.

    Where Can You Find Giant Oceanic Manta Rays?

    Giant oceanic manta rays are predominantly found in tropical and subtropical waters around the world. They inhabit regions such as the Maldives, Indonesia, the Gulf of Mexico, and the Great Barrier Reef. These areas provide the warm temperatures and abundant plankton necessary for their survival.

    While they are most commonly spotted in open ocean environments, giant oceanic manta rays occasionally venture closer to shore, especially during feeding seasons. Coastal areas with strong upwellings, which bring nutrient-rich water to the surface, are particularly attractive to these rays.

    For divers and snorkelers, encountering a giant oceanic manta ray is a once-in-a-lifetime experience. Popular dive sites, such as Hanifaru Bay in the Maldives, offer opportunities to observe these majestic creatures in their natural habitat. However, it's important to approach them with care and respect, as they are sensitive to disturbances.

    Why Are Giant Oceanic Manta Rays Important to the Ecosystem?

    Giant oceanic manta rays play a vital role in maintaining the health of marine ecosystems. As filter feeders, they help regulate plankton populations, preventing algal blooms that can harm coral reefs. Their feeding activities also contribute to nutrient cycling, as they redistribute nutrients across different ocean layers.

    Furthermore, these rays serve as indicators of ocean health. Their sensitivity to environmental changes makes them valuable subjects for studying the impacts of climate change, pollution, and overfishing. Declining manta populations often signal broader issues within marine ecosystems, highlighting the need for conservation efforts.

    What Are the Major Threats to Giant Oceanic Manta Rays?

    Despite their ecological importance, giant oceanic manta rays face numerous threats. Overfishing is one of the most significant challenges, as their gill plates are highly valued in traditional medicine markets. Habitat destruction, caused by coastal development and pollution, also poses a major risk to their survival.

    Climate change further exacerbates these threats by altering ocean temperatures and disrupting plankton distribution. As a result, giant oceanic manta rays may struggle to find sufficient food, leading to population declines. Conservation initiatives, such as marine protected areas and international trade regulations, are critical for safeguarding their future.

    How Long Do Giant Oceanic Manta Rays Live?

    Giant oceanic manta rays can live up to 40-50 years in the wild. Their long lifespan makes them particularly vulnerable to threats such as overfishing and habitat loss.

    Are Giant Oceanic Manta Rays Dangerous to Humans?

    No, giant oceanic manta rays are not dangerous to humans. They are gentle creatures that feed on plankton and pose no threat to people. However, it's important to maintain a respectful distance when observing them in the wild.
